Tech Stack
Experience with our specific technologies is not required, and our stack is constantly evolving. Here's what we're using now:
Front-end:
- React + TypeScript
- Chakra UI with focus on a11y
- Jest + React Testing Library for unit tests
- Playwright for end-to-end tests
Back-end + Database:
- GraphQL with Hasura
- AWS Lambda with NodeJS / TypeScript and Go.
- AWS Serverless Services: Fargate, Aurora, S3, SNS
- AWS RDS with PostgreSQL
DevOps:
- AWS CDK for Infrastructure as Code
- AWS CodeBuild and AWS Codepipeline
- AWS Amplify for Front-End
Company
Avela is a Nobel Prize-winning edtech startup building the first universal application for PK-12 education, daycare, and enrichment programs, promoting equity and access to education.
For students and families, this simplifies the process of finding and applying to educational programming. For schools and districts, this streamlines operations and helps increase enrollment (and hence, revenue).
We sell our application and enrollment platform directly to school districts, charter networks, other educational providers, cities, and states. We work with school districts and charter networks across the country, including in Oakland, Seattle, Hartford, Tulsa, New Orleans, Newark, and Jersey City. We also work with a range of nonprofits and NGOs, including Teach for America and the Inter-American Development Bank, as well as the US Military.
Our platform has four parts to cover each stage of the application journey, from exploring options to applying and final selection and admission:
Avela Explore - Mobile-optimized school finder and opportunity navigator
Avela Apply - Streamlined application management system and tracking
Avela Match - Research-based admission and student assignment lottery system.
We also offer a range of consulting services to help districts implement enrollment reforms and advance equity in educational programs.
